Among these, the Omni E35 robot vacuum and robot mower stand out for their key improvements and features over previous generations. The Omni E35, potentially the last Eufy model, is designed to address the needs of asthmatic cats due to its sterilization and disinfection capabilities.

It is TÜV Rheinland-certified for the "Maternal and Infant Cleaning Robot mark" and has been recognized by the Asthma & Allergy Foundation of America as the first and only robot vacuum to earn the Asthma & Allergy Friendly Certification. This vacuum is equipped with 35,000 pascals of suction and the Hydro Jet 2.0 self-cleaning roller mop, along with a kitchen deep clean mode that tackles tougher stains.

It will be available from September 25, with pre-orders starting on September 4 at $900 (originally $1,100). The Eufy S2 Max, Anker's first robot mower developed entirely in-house, features vision-based SLAM navigation, real-time 3D mapping, all-wheel drive, and a dual blade system. Its availability in the US and pricing are yet to be determined, but it will be launched in EU markets in May 2027. Anker plans to consolidate all its sub-brands under the Anker brand.
